Burnham is a village in the south of the county between Slough and Maidenhead (both of which are in Berkshire).
This category include sites in Burnham, Burnham Common, East Burnham, Burnham Beeches and Littleworth Common, all administered by South Bucks. District Council. The parish of Burnham contains much undeveloped Green Belt land and includes the ancient woodlands at Burnham Beeches.
